Carbon is a R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) framework that helps developers connect external data sources to Large Language Models. The platform provides pre-built connectors to ingest unstructured data from any source and load it into any destination, with AI-ready data processing that chunks, embeds, and cleans content for optimal LLM performance. Carbon was designed to simplify building RAG applications with features including credentials and content encryption at rest and in transit, full SOC 2 Type II compliance, and advanced data processing capabilities. In December 2024, Carbon was acquired by Perplexity AI to enhance their enterprise search capabilities, allowing users to search through files and work messages in Notion, Google Docs, Slack, and other enterprise applications.
Pathway is a high-performance Python ETL framework for stream processing, real-time analytics, LLM pipelines, and RAG. The Rust-powered engine treats data as a continuous stream of changes rather than static snapshots — making it a natural fit for AI applications that need to stay in sync with live data sources.
Pathway connects to PostgreSQL, Kafka, S3, and live APIs, monitoring them for changes and automatically processing updates while incrementally maintaining vector databases. A unique capability: mixing batch and streaming logic in the same workflow, so systems can be continuously trained with new streaming data and revised without requiring full batch reuploads. The framework supports stateless and stateful transformations (joins, windowing, sorting), with many transformations implemented in Rust.
Pathway provides dedicated LLM tooling for live LLM/RAG pipelines, with wrappers for common LLM services. Used in production at NATO and Intel for real-time streaming AI workloads. Recently crossed 50K GitHub stars on the strength of its 'fresh data for AI' positioning — a deployment-first architecture that solves the real-time data challenge other RAG frameworks struggle with.
